Kernelul Linux reprezinta nucleul central al sistemului de operare Linux si este o componenta vitala care gestioneaza resursele hardware si faciliteaza interactiunea intre software si hardware. In acest articol, vom explora cu atentie ce este un kernel Linux si cum functioneaza, aducand in prim plan importanta sa in lumea tehnologiei.
Iata pe scurt o descriere a kernelului Linux:
Continutul articolului
Ce Este un Kernel Linux?
Kernelul Linux este un program de baza care actioneaza ca intermediar intre software-ul de pe sistemul de operare si componentele hardware ale unui calculator. Este responsabil pentru gestionarea memoriei, proceselor, sistemului de fisiere si a driverelor, oferind un mediu de lucru pentru aplicatiile software.
Esti curios ce este Linux? Iata pe scurt un rezumat:
Functionalitatile Cheie ale Kernelului Linux:
Dupa cum poti vedea si in figura de mai jos, kernelul poarta un rol foarte important in modul in care functioneaza un calculator/PC/Laptop (incluzand sistemul de operare si aplicatiile acestuia):
Astfel, rolul kernelului este de a:
Gestiona Memoria: Kernelul asigura alocarea si dezalocarea eficienta a memoriei, asigurand ca aplicatiile ruleaza in mod corespunzator si fara conflicte.
Procesarea Task-urilor: Se ocupa de planificarea si coordonarea proceselor in sistem, garantand o distributie echitabila a resurselor CPU.
Sistemul de Fisiere: Kernelul Linux faciliteaza accesul la date prin intermediul sistemului de fisiere, gestionand citirea si scrierea acestora pe discuri si alte dispozitive de stocare.
Interactiunea cu Hardware-ul: Kernelul furnizeaza driverele necesare pentru a permite software-ului sa comunice cu hardware-ul, inclusiv cu componente precum placile grafice, retea si dispozitive de stocare.
Importanta Kernelului Linux:
Stabilitate si Performanta: Kernelul Linux este cunoscut pentru stabilitatea si performanta sa remarcabila. El este proiectat pentru a functiona eficient si fiabil intr-o gama variata de medii si configuratii hardware.
Suport Pentru Diversitatea Hardware-ului: Datorita modelului sau de dezvoltare deschis, kernelul Linux beneficiaza de suportul unei comunitati mari de dezvoltatori, asigurand compatibilitate extinsa cu o gama larga de dispozitive hardware.
Securitate Avansata: Kernelul Linux este construit cu un accent puternic pe securitate. Actualizarile constante si auditarea codului sunt practici obisnuite pentru a asigura protectia impotriva vulnerabilitatilor de securitate.
Viitorul Kernelului Linux:
Evolutia continua a tehnologiei aduce noi provocari si oportunitati pentru kernelul Linux. Inovatii precum suportul pentru hardware modern, optimizari de performanta si securitate avansata vor continua sa defineasca viitorul acestei componente esentiale a sistemului de operare.
In concluzie, kernelul Linux poate fi considerat inima pulsatoare a sistemului de operare Linux, aducand stabilitate, performanta si securitate. Cu o comunitate activa si angajata in spate, acesta ramane un pilon esential in lumea software-ului open-source.
Vrei sa inveti si mai multe despre Kernel, Linux, Servere si Securitate IT?
Urmareste tutorialul de mai jos pentru a afla cum sa faci Reconversie Profesionala in Securitate IT (Linux, Servere, Retele, Securitate Cibernetica) in mai putin de 12 luni, pornind de la zero
💻 Doresti sa faci reconversie profesionala pe partea de Securitate IT? Participa la urmatorul curs de Securitate Cibernetica cu mentorat din partea lui Ramon Nastase. Completeaza acum, formularul de inscriere de aici: LINK